Subject: Dedupe cut-over complete

Team — the switch to Quellhorn, our new alert deduplicator, finished last night. Old pipeline is dark; all pages now flow through Quellhorn's grouping rules. Net effect: fewer duplicate pages, same underlying alerts. If a page looks merged wrong, flag it in channel. For reference, Quellhorn is live with the following configuration values.

deployment values, yadup-kadug:
[sorys]
port = 5672
team = noveth
host = sorys.orvexcorp.example
region = south-4
access_code = ac_deddc1
timeout_ms = 1500

**Alert: HermeticMigrate — non-hermetic dependency detected**

This alert fires when the Quillstone build migration pipeline detects a target fetching artifacts outside the sealed Brixen toolchain. For security review purposes, each occurrence is logged with the offending rule, its declared inputs, and the network egress attempted. The full audit trail and remediation procedure are maintained on the internal migration tracking page.

wiki page, tahaf-tajog: https://jira.ordindyn.corp/pipeline

Minutes — Board Session, Ravelin Holdings

Present: full board; apologies from none. Sole agenda item: revised sales-commission scheme. New structure caps accelerators at tier three and shifts weighting toward multi-year contracts. Finance confirmed the model is cost-neutral against current attainment. Rollout set for the next quarter; comms drafted by Elsbeth Marrow. Objections noted from the eastern division, deferred. The confidential rationale is recorded below.

board note of kageg-bahof: The renewal with Holwynax Holdings closes at $2 million a year, 5 percent below the last contract. Project Ulaath slips by two quarters because of the supplier delay.

Timeline entry, 14:22 — The Wrenfield kiosk watchdog began force-restarting the app every ninety seconds after the midday content push. Cause: the health endpoint returned slow responses while the media cache rebuilt, and the watchdog threshold was set too tight. Mitigation was raising the timeout and redeploying. The affected kiosks all ran the build identified by the token below.

pipeline stamp: htk31_f769b577b3028a4e9958e5bb8d1259a